Jimmy V is an experimental hip hop artist from Monticello, NY and relocated to San Antonio.
I have been able to develop a distinctive experimental sound that blends elements of hip hop, electronic music, and ambient soundscapes.
In 2015 I moved to Denver and became apart of the DIY artist collective within Rhinoceropolis. I have been able to earn a dedicated following, tour nationally, and had the oppurtunity to collaborate with prominent figures internationally including Lil Peep and Team Sesh.
After relocating to San Antonio I accomplished being signed to Orange Milk records while continuing to produce original music.
Although, I am primarily a musician I have recently began to use my ability to connect with others to create a safe space to support other creatives. I hope to push the boundaries of what is possible in the art world and influence others to pursue their creative talents.
